VANCOUVER – MacEwan's Grace Mwasalla was named Canada West Women's Soccer Player of the Week on Tuesday after leading the Griffins to a big win over Calgary that clinched top spot in the Central Division.

Mwasalla helped the MacEwan Griffins lock up first place, recording a goal and an assist in Sunday's 3-0 win over the Calgary Dinos.

The win, MacEwan's 10th of the season, kept the Dinos at bay in the second seed and means the Griffins will host a Canada West quarter-final, rather than hit the road for the start of the playoffs. 

Mwasalla took over the game on Sunday scoring the opening goal of the match in the 8th minute, adding an assist in the 90th minute. The first-year midfielder from Chatham, Ont. also came up with a clutch defensive play that stopped the Dinos attack and led to the ball going the other way to set up MacEwan's second goal in the 68th minute. 

The Griffins (10-2-0) host the third seed out of the West Division, the Fraser Valley Cascades (6-4-2) at 1 p.m. on Saturday (Clarke Stadium). The Canada West Quarter-final can be seen live on Canada West TV presented by Co-op.
